ICAO has confirmed that international passenger traffic fell 60% during 2020, bringing air travel totals back to 2003 levels. ICAO data shows that seat capacity fell by 50% last year, with just 1.8 billion passengers compared to 4.5 billion in 2019. ICAO predicts airline financial losses of $370 billion resulting from the impact of COVID-19, with airports and air navigation services providers (ANSPs) losing a further 115 billion and 13 billion, respectively. The pandemic plunge in air travel demand began in January of 2020, but was limited to only a few countries.
